Jordan Craig Reviews
Jordan Craig has highly polarized reviews, with shoppers either satisfied with their product quality and delivery or deeply frustrated with shipping issues and customer service. Positive reviewers praise accurate product descriptions, proper fit, and timely standard shipping. However, the majority of recent reviews highlight serious problems: packages going missing in transit, poor refund handling, unexplained order delays without tracking updates, and frustration with the mandatory Neighborhood Watch protection program for shipping claims. Customers report that the company deflects responsibility for lost packages and denies refunds, instead pushing the optional insurance service or third-party claim processes that shoppers feel were imposed without clear consent.
A recurring complaint involves the interplay between high shipping costs (including optional protection fees) and the company's unwillingness to take accountability when deliveries fail. Long-time customers express particular disappointment, suggesting a recent decline in service standards. The return and claims process itself draws criticism for involving a third party rather than direct resolution, leaving shoppers feeling the system is designed to avoid reimbursement rather than help them.
